Anonim

Een lezer schreef ons deze week en vroeg naar het bestand 'ntuser.dat' op hun Windows 10-computer. In het bijzonder: 'Wat is ntuser.dat en waarom verschijnt het steeds op mijn computer? Ik heb het twee keer verwijderd en het blijft verschijnen. Waarom?' Dit is iets dat we eerder hebben gezien in opmerkingen en e-mails, dus het is een goed onderwerp voor een zelfstudie.

U kunt ntuser.dat vinden in C: \ Users \ Gebruikersnaam. Het is een relatief klein bestand dat onschuldig staat. De mijne is 6 MB groot. Het is geen virus. Het is geen malware. Het is niets om je zorgen over te maken. Het bestand is eigenlijk essentieel voor uw computer en u moet het niet verwijderen.

Wat is ntuser.dat?

Het bestand ntuser.dat is waar uw Windows-gebruikersprofiel wordt geladen. Het bevat de HKEY_CURRENT_USER registercomponent waarin al uw bestanden, voorkeuren en instellingen zijn opgenomen. Als u het bestand verwijdert, keren veel van deze instellingen terug naar hun standaardwaarden. Alle configuratiewijzigingen of aanpassingen die in het register worden onderhouden, keren ook terug naar de standaardwaarden.

Het doel van ntuser.dat is waarom het opnieuw verschijnt als u het verwijdert. Het bestand is nodig om al uw registerinstellingen te behouden. Elke gebruiker op de computer heeft zijn eigen kopie die zijn individuele instellingen behoudt. Als u naar C: \ Users gaat en alle gebruikersnaammappen binnenin controleert, ziet u dat elk een bestand ntuser.dat heeft.

De bestandsnaam is een erfenis van WindowsNT die het heeft geïntroduceerd om gebruikersinstellingen te helpen handhaven in een multi-user omgeving. Het formaat is nu grotendeels hetzelfde. U kunt ntuser.dat echter niet openen of lezen.

Hoe werkt ntuser.dat?

Zoals het achtervoegsel suggereert, is ntuser.dat een gegevensbestand dat niet alleen de registercomponent bevat, maar ook logboeken met eerdere versies van die component. Wanneer u wijzigingen aanbrengt op uw computer en de component wordt bijgewerkt, wordt de vorige versie vastgelegd en kan Windows Restore uw computer helpen terug te keren naar een vorige configuratie. Die logboeken verwijzen naar andere exemplaren van ntuser.dat die u mogelijk in de map ziet.

Wanneer u een wijziging aanbrengt die in het register wordt weerspiegeld, wordt deze niet onmiddellijk geschreven. Het wordt bewaard in een tijdelijk bestand dat een regtrans-ms-bestand wordt genoemd. Dit is een logbestand dat alle wijzigingen bijhoudt die u in een enkele sessie aanbrengt waarvoor een registerwijziging nodig is. Pas nadat u zich hebt afgemeld of uw computer hebt afgesloten, worden uw wijzigingen door het regtrans-ms-bestand in het register opgeslagen.

Het idee is om de integriteit van het register te handhaven door aanpassing tot een minimum te beperken. In plaats van er altijd naar te schrijven, wordt er tijdens het afsluiten van uw computer een tijdelijk bestand gemaakt, gecontroleerd, gevalideerd en vervolgens naar het register geschreven. Die vertraging die u ziet wanneer u uw computer instelt op afsluiten of wanneer u uitlogt? Dat is onder andere het regtrans-ms-bestand dat in het register wordt geschreven en naar ntuser.dat wordt gekopieerd.

Wat gebeurt er als ik het bestand ntuser.dat verwijder?

Zoals vermeld, is de ntuser.dat een belangrijk bestand voor Windows omdat het al uw gebruikersconfiguraties en HKEY_CURRENT_USER-instellingen bevat. Als u het bestand verwijdert, crasht Windows niet, maar kunnen alle configuraties of systeeminstellingen die gewoonlijk in het register zijn opgenomen, verdwijnen.

Niet alle systeeminstellingen of wijzigingen moeten in het register worden vastgelegd, dus als u het verwijdert, ziet u mogelijk dat sommige wijzigingen overblijven terwijl andere opnieuw worden ingesteld.

U kunt de huidige ntuser.dat die in gebruik is door uw account niet verwijderen. Als u meerdere ntuser.dat-bestanden ziet, kunt u deze verwijderen als u dat wilt. Meerdere ntuser.dat-bestanden in C: \ Users \ Gebruikersnaam geven aan dat uw computer is gecrasht en niet naar het register kon schrijven zoals het hoort tijdens een normale uitschakeling. In plaats van een mogelijk beschadigd bestand te schrijven, negeert Windows het om een ​​nieuw bestand te maken. Tijdens een crash zou het regtrans-ms-bestand niet naar ntuser.dat zijn geschreven, dus het wordt verwijderd.

Systeemwijzigingen die normaal in het register worden vastgelegd tijdens de gecrashte sessie, zijn niet opgeslagen, dus u moet deze opnieuw doen. In deze situatie zijn de oudere ntuser.dat-bestanden nu verouderd en worden ze vervangen door de nieuwste versie van het bestand. Dit is wat ervoor zorgt dat meerdere ntuser.dat-bestanden verschijnen.

Meerdere ntuser.dat-bestanden kunnen veilig worden verwijderd zolang u de nieuwste niet verwijdert. In de meeste situaties moet u het gebruikte bestand kunnen verwijderen, omdat dit door Windows wordt vergrendeld.

Het is normaal om ntuser.dat in uw map Gebruikersnaam te zien en dit is al lang het kenmerk van Windows. Het bestand is veilig, het is geen malware of iets slechts. Het is een noodzakelijk onderdeel van Windows en kan veilig met rust worden gelaten. Als u oudere versies wilt verwijderen, kunt u dat, maar met slechts een paar megabytes, is er echt geen noodzaak. Maar het is helemaal aan jou.

Wat is ntuser.dat en waarom is het op mijn computer?